Do note that DirtFish do make commercial co-operation with several drivers and events, in other words those drivers and events pay DirtFish to produce and publish content about them. It can create a bit of a weird situation when they co-operate with one but not with the other and especially if there is something negative to report about. DirtFish is OK as long as you know how to read them. The worst thing DirtFish did was pretty killing all rallying content from Autosport - and I'm silly enough to believe Autosport works or worked more independently.
The job of wrc.com is just to create content to support the championship. It's fully open commercial operation. It still could be better, way better, but in a way, at least myself, I don't expect anything from them.Photos: rallirinki.kuvat.fi | Twitter: @HartusvuoriWRC
